Ratio Decidendi

The appropriate sentence for using a forged identity card to obtain employment is 14 months' imprisonment (12 months base as per Chan Man Mo plus 2 months for producing the forged card to a police officer); for eight breaches of condition of stay 6 months' imprisonment is appropriate for each count to be concurrent, with 3 months of that concurrent total ordered to run consecutively to the sentence for the forged identity offence, producing an overall effective sentence of 17 months, which satisfies the totality principle.

Court Disposition

Appeal allowed in part to vary sentences

Orders

  • Impose 14 months' imprisonment on Charge 1 (Using a forged identity card).
  • Impose 6 months' imprisonment on each of Charges 2–9 (Breaches of condition of stay), to run concurrently with each other.
